Output 51cc5bee9c54143ef008bebd7a288e073c6cfdce5fc1764c7d22f858f67f1d7f:7

value
18164192
script pubkey
OP_0 OP_PUSHBYTES_20 94509680aeb2b6758b5d3b16e5262b6c88adf012
address
bc1qj3gfdq9wk2m8tz6a8vtw2f3tdjy2muqjpv57ht
transaction
51cc5bee9c54143ef008bebd7a288e073c6cfdce5fc1764c7d22f858f67f1d7f
spent
true